#E36CAD Hex Color Code

#E36CAD

The Hexadecimal Color #E36CAD is a contrast shade of Pale Violet Red. #E36CAD RGB value is rgb(227, 108, 173). RGB Color Model of #E36CAD consists of 89% red, 42% green and 67% blue. HSL color Mode of #E36CAD has 327°(degrees) Hue, 68% Saturation and 66% Lightness. #E36CAD color has an wavelength of 414.11111n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E36CAD is #FF99C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E36CAD is #D6A. The Closest Color to #E36CAD is #DB7093. Official Name of #E36CAD Hex Code is Hot Pink.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E36CAD is 0 Cyan 52 Magenta 24 Yellow 11 Black and #E36CAD CMY is 0, 52, 24.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E36CAD is hsl(327,68,66,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(327, 52, 89).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E36CAD is 44.59, 30.08, 42.98.
Hex8 Value of #E36CAD is #E36CADFF. Decimal Value of #E36CAD is 14904493 and Octal Value of #E36CAD is 70666255. Binary Value of #E36CAD is 11100011, 1101100, 10101101 and Android of #E36CAD is 4293094573 / 0xffe36cad.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E36CAD is 0.379, 0.256, 0.256 and YIQ Color Space of #E36CAD is 150.991, 50.0276, 45.3965.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E36CAD is 38.62, 19.95, 42.81.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E36CAD is 61.72, 53.5, -12.71.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E36CAD is 61.72, 70.34, -28.09.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E36CAD is 61.72, 54.99, 346.64. Hunter Lab variable of #E36CAD is 54.85, 49.14, -8.07.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E36CAD

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
